Output 101aeb7613b827f7f271978b07c0c908390bb6ab646a820f0be483643d4b38d0:0

value
2845300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a85d26912bb68559b28ed190c2d8a6a3ecd4250 OP_EQUAL
address
3QXfAcPue6eTLxdmG8WLc989a21LyGuRNU
transaction
101aeb7613b827f7f271978b07c0c908390bb6ab646a820f0be483643d4b38d0
confirmations
416107
spent
true